Hi Yannig, yes, be patient. ORS is no commercial 99.999% availability service. It's a server at the University of Heidelberg and part of their research. Thus it's down quite frequently. A good test is their own homepage. If that can't calculate routes, QLGT won't either. I just tested. It's down right now.
